SWAT standoff in Harrison resolved; man in custody

A Harrison man who family members said threatened them with guns overnight surrendered this afternoon to Hamilton County SWAT officers.

William Scott Merritt, came out of his home at 6229 Bayshore Drive about 4 p.m. and was arrested without incident, Sheriff's Office spokeswoman Janice Atkinson said. She said the call came in shortly after 11 a.m. today.

"Deputies spoke with family members before making contact with Mr. Merritt and found that he threatened to kill them last night while holding a weapon," Atkinson said in a news release. "They also relayed to law enforcement, he had a large number of rifles and semiautomatic weapons."

Atkinson said Merritt is charged with two counts of aggravated assault.

SWAT vans, rescue vehicles and an ambulance staged in the faculty parking lot at Harrison Elementary School on Highway 58.
